Population activity is an indicator that measures the share of the working population in the total population. Population activity is economically linked to value added or economic growth in a region and socially it provides information on, among other things, the demographic structure of the population.

Employment in Draßburg
The activity rate in Draßburg is 67,10%. The population activity of neighbouring municipalities is shown in the table of neighbouring municipalities.
Activity rate in Neighboring municipalities
- Activity rate in Baumgarten : 66,20%
- Activity rate in Rohrbach : 68,40%
- Activity rate in Loipersbach : 69,00%
- Activity rate in Zagersdorf : 71,20%
- Activity rate in Antau : 72,20%
- Activity rate in Schattendorf : 72,30%
- Activity rate in Zemendorf Stöttera : 74,50%
